Congratulations Sr Agnieszka and Sr Mattibashisha
Sr. Agnieszka and Sr. Mattibashisha renewed their vows this morning in the presence of our community here in Rome. We thank the good Lord for His continuous love shown to these young sisters of ours. We pray that He continues blessing them with good health, their apostolate, and their spiritual life. A visit from St Paul, MN
This morning, the 5th of January, 2026, we have had the great joy of welcoming Fr Scott, Fr Nels, and Fr Joseph, along with a group of deacons, seminarians, and three religious brothers, to our community here in Rome. Every year, this group visits us to learn, hear about our missionary vocation, our Mother foundress, and our missionary apostolate.
